Watermedium

Keep evenly moist in growth; drier in winter.

Lighthigh

Very bright light; some morning sun.

Foodmedium

High-nitrogen feed in growth; bloom booster in late summer.

Temp

45-85°F (7-29°C)

Humidity

40-60%

Origin

Special care:Cool autumn nights down to 45°F trigger spikes.
